Systematic Investment Plan vs Enhanced Systematic Investment Plan : Which Investment Strategy is Superior?
Deciding between a standard Recurring Investment and a Enhanced Recurring Investment can be challenging for beginning investors . A regular Recurring Investment involves allocating a predetermined amount periodically into a fund . However , a Enhanced SIP lets you incrementally boost your amount over time . While the latter can arguably boost yields and align expanded income, it also necessitates more discipline . Consider your monetary situation and appetite before opting for either option .
